Highest Paying AI Jobs (2025 Data)
In 2025, the AI industry offers some of the most lucrative career opportunities in the technology space.
AI jobs are generally high paying, especially at top tech companies like OpenAI, Netflix, Facebook, and Uber.
So let's see the highest-paying AI jobs right now (based on the latest 2025 data).
1. NLP Engineer - (Average Annual Salary: $157,240)
5-year search growth: 181%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 1.9k/month
Average Annual Salary: $157,240
Description: An NLP engineer can build programs that process and analyze natural language data. NLP engineers work with large-scale datasets, create benchmarking data, and perform thorough statistical analysis when training these models. The growth of generative AI tools like ChatGPT is why the NLP market is expected to reach $43 billion by 2025.
2. AI Product Manager - (Average Annual Salary: $182,587)
5-year search growth: 1,760%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 4.9k/month
Average Annual Salary: $182,587
Description: An AI product manager guides the development and launch of AI products. This job’s primary responsibility is to be the bridge between users and internal teams so a company can ship valuable products and features. Netflix recently advertised an open AI product manager role with a $300,000 to $900,000 annual salary range.
3. AI Engineer - (Average Annual Salary: $134,914)
5-year search growth: 1,640%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 42.9k/month
Average Annual Salary: $134,914
Description: Artificial intelligence engineers build computer programs and applications that can think and learn like humans. These engineers develop these tools using AI and machine learning techniques. This role combines different skills like software development, programming, and data science.
4. Computer Vision Engineer - (Average Annual Salary: $132,077)
5-year search growth: 101%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 2.3k/month
Average Annual Salary: $132,077
Description: Computer vision engineers build applications and programs that can process large datasets and make sense of images. Industries that rely heavily on CV engineers include autonomous vehicles, robotics, augmented reality, and virtual reality.
5. Machine Learning Engineer - (Average Annual Salary: $164,048)
5-year search growth: 194%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 25.2k/month
Average Annual Salary: $164,048
Description: Machine learning engineers can use data to train ML algorithms and models. These self-learning applications need to be trained and retrained to adapt and evolve. According to the 2025 Future Of Jobs Report, machine learning engineers are one of the top three fastest growing jobs.

6. AI Scientist - (Average Annual Salary: $122,738)
5-year search growth: 615%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 4.8k/month
Average Annual Salary: $122,738
Description: An AI Scientist, often known as an Artificial Intelligence Researcher or Scientist, can develop complex algorithms for AI tools. The scientist is the mastermind during the development phase. For example, OpenAI is currently hiring an AI Research Scientist with an advertised salary range between $295,000-$440,000.
7. AI Data Scientist - (Average Annual Salary: $126,950)
5-year search growth: 380%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 1.9k/month
Average Annual Salary: $126,950
Description: AI data scientists extract insights from data and apply those insights to the development of new AI, machine learning, and computer vision models. OpenAI is currently hiring for multiple data scientist roles, offering an annual salary between $245,000 to $310,000.
8. AI Architect - (Average Annual Salary: $148,441)
5-year search growth: 1,329%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 9.9k/month
Average Annual Salary: $148,441
Description: An AI Architect designs and oversees the structure of AI solutions. The primary function of this position is to find flaws in existing models and applications to help developers and engineers improve the product. The AI architect is analytical with excellent communication and project management skills.
9. AI Researcher - (Average Annual Salary: $125,979)
5-year search growth: 889%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 7.6k/month
Average Annual Salary: $125,979
Description: An AI Researcher explores the foundational theories and concepts of artificial intelligence. They conduct experiments, publish their findings, and work on pushing the boundaries of what AI can achieve. Researchers work closely with engineering, product, and development teams to push product innovation.
10. Data Engineer - (Average Annual Salary: $127,806)
5-year search growth: 273%
Search growth status: Exploding
Search Volume (Global): 110k/month
Average Annual Salary: $127,806
Description: Data engineers create and maintain data infrastructures for storage and process. This role is becoming more important for AI to turn new, raw data into a usable form. These datasets are how generative AI models like ChatGPT get trained.
What Is The Highest-Paying AI Job?
According to the most recent data collected by Glassdoor, an AI Product Manager is the highest-paying AI job. This position earns an average annual salary of $182,587.
The next highest-paying AI job is a machine learning engineer with an annual salary of $164,048. This is much higher than the average engineer. In the United States, an engineer earns an average annual salary of $123,937. The machine learning engineer position is one example of how AI is driving increased salaries for specific roles.

Artificial Intelligence (AI) Career Trends
According to a report by the World Economic Forum, AI is expected to replace 85 million jobs by 2025. However, AI will also create 97 million new jobs by 2027. This is a 12 million (or 14.1%) net increase in jobs.
The demand for AI Research Scientists is expected to grow rapidly at 21% between 2021 to 2031.
It’s projected that jobs requiring AI or machine learning skills will grow by 71% between 2021 and 2025.
Source: World Economic Forum, BLS, Forbes
